Heaven and Hell:

A young man wanted to know the difference between Heaven and Hell. The sage led him to two rooms, one labelled Heaven and one Hell. Looking in at Hell he saw a banquet table filled with luscious food but the people at the table were emaciated and distressed. Their spoons had long handles to reach the food, but the handles were too long to bring the food to their mouths. Then he looked in on Heaven. Same table full of luscious food. Same long spoons. But the people were healthy and happy and using their long-handled spoons to feed one another . . .
